+ THE RAILWAY EXCHANGE

    (Also known as THE SANTE FE BUILDING)

    D. H. BURNHAM AND COMPANY,  Architects

    224 South Michigan Ave | Chicago 



     
    Gleaming white terra cotta covers the structure.  This image borders the parapet.  The building is
    attributed to Burnham Designer Frederick Dinkelberg. Dinkelberg went on to design the 
    Heyworth Building and 35 East Wacker, both in Chicago
